Certain summer sandals may be to blame for knee, hip and back pain. "It has no torque support, it's got no arch support and although it is rubber and you would think it has good cushioning, but it doesn't even have that good of a cushion," explained Podiatrist Dr. Richard Green. A new study from the American College Of Sports Medicine found flip-flop wearers tend to take smaller strides, and alter the way they walk just to keep the sandals on. You can love them and feel good too. Just choose a pair with these three key elements. First, arch support. Second, a thick sole. Third, a heel stopper. Flip-flops can cost between two bucks to upwards of 80-dollars a pair. But, price doesn't necessarily make it a better fit. So again, look for the pair that has the added support and cushion. After all, most of us take a ten to 20-thousand steps a day, so you want to make each one as comfortable as possible.
